This article describes how to create, modify and delete a folder within Smart ID Certificate Manager (CM).
A folder can be used to hold references to any of the Certificate Authority (CA) entities (such as keys, officers, certificates etc.), so that related entities can be located easily. A typical folder tree could contain all the keys, procedures and officers relevant to a CA or its subordinate CAs.
These tasks are done in the Administrator's workbench (AWB) .
Prerequisites
The following prerequisites apply:
-
A connection to the CM host must have been established, see Connect to a Certificate Manager host .
Create folder
-
In AWB, select New > Folder.
-
In the Create Folder Request dialog, enter a folder name in Name.
-
If the new folder is to be a sub-folder of an existing folder, click the Parent browse button to open the Select Folder window. Otherwise leave Parent empty to create a top-level folder.
Warning: Do not use the Delete option of the shortcut menu to remove any parent folder name from the Parent field, as this will delete the parent folder. Use the Clean option.
-
In Contents, click + to open the Select an entity window.
-
Select the required entity and click OK. Repeat steps 4 and 5 until all the relevant entities have been entered into the folder contents.
-
Click OK to return to the AWB window. The new folder is displayed in the explorer bar.
Modify folder
-
In AWB, select the folder to be modified.
-
Select Modify from the Edit menu, the toolbar or the entity's shortcut menu.
-
You can:
-
modify the Name that should appear in the explorer bar of the AWB window.
-
add or remove entities with the + and - buttons.
-
change the display order of the entities with the > and < buttons.
-
-
Click OK when done.
Delete folder
-
In AWB, select the folder to be deleted.
-
Select Delete from the Edit menu, the toolbar or the entity's shortcut menu.
-
Click Yes in the Confirm delete dialog box.
-
Select Refresh to remove the deleted folder from the AWB window.
